Cardigan refashion

From this:


Big 80s bat wing cardigan - to this:

Fitted cropped jacket. :-)

I used my perfect shirt pattern to cut out the pieces. The bottom of the sweater became the body of the jacket, and the rest became the sleeves. I managed to use the existing bands everywhere except at the neck, where I sewed on a piece of knit found among remnants. The same fabric was used to make the bow.
Also, I added a button in between the two existing ones and added a snap at the neckline to keep the jacket closed.

I will happily wear the little jacket as a liseuse - bed jacket, to keep me warm at night. :-)

So, everything used in this project was repurposed and I'm pretty satisfied!
